Recognizing A Glass Of Wine Tasting Terms


Familiarity with essential red wine tasting terms can enrich the experience. Right here are some essential terms:



  • Fragrance: The smell of the white wine, which can reveal much concerning its qualities.

  • Arrangement: A term used to explain the facility fragrances that establish as a white wine ages.

  • Tannin: An all-natural substance discovered in grape skins that contributes to the red wine's appearance and anger.

  • Finish: The preference that remains after ingesting, which shows high quality and intricacy.


In Berkeley, neighborhood vineyards commonly give references or guides to assist participants comprehend these terms. Knowing these will certainly make it less complicated to verbalize personal choices and provide valuable responses.

Famous Grapes and Blends of the Bay Area


The Bay Location is renowned for varieties like Cabernet Sauvignon, Chardonnay, and Pinot Noir. Berkeley vineyards commonly concentrate on smaller sized, lesser-known varietals such as Grenache and Sangiovese, which thrive in the region's microclimates.


Many wineries produce compelling blends that show neighborhood terroir. For example, the blending of Zinfandel with Small Sirah creates a rich, strong flavor profile that brings in enthusiasts. These unique combinations highlight the innovation of regional wine makers.


In addition to standout grapes, Bay Area wineries are likewise commended for their specialty red wines. Dessert wines made from late-harvest grapes and charming shimmering alternatives contribute to the area's variety.


Organic and Lasting Wine Making


Sustainability is an essential focus for lots of Bay Area wineries. Several wineries stress natural practices, reducing reliance on artificial pesticides and fertilizers. This dedication to the environment interest eco-conscious consumers and boosts the top quality of a glass of wine.


Cutting-edge strategies, such as dry farming and cover cropping, are prevalent in Berkeley vineyards. These approaches promote biodiversity and improve dirt health. The result is not just a favorable ecological impact but also grapes that share the region's character.


Numerous wineries are accredited organic or biodynamic, permitting transparency in their cultivation methods. This activity toward sustainability proves beneficial for both the environment and the neighborhood a glass of wine neighborhood, cultivating a culture of liability and top quality.
